Any reason I cant get a 250 or larger and just clone my 360 HDD to it, shove it in the case, and use it on the 360?
#2   dondino - Posted 8:50 am PDT 10/14/09 (48 Posts)
You can't just buy any off the shelf 2.5 drive and clone your 360 drive. Only specific models with specific modified firmwares will work with an xbox.

#7   JF1081 - Posted 10:24 am PDT 10/14/09 (251 Posts)
You can install games to the hard drive now (5-7 GB each). The advantage of doing that is so you don't have to spin the DVD drive to run the game - you have have to have the game disc in there, but it reads most of the data from the HDD.
